Enduring Confrontation

  • New scenario for Enduring Confrontation: naval convoys. On the map border, naval convoys will appear which will move towards the sea ports of their respective team. Whilst the convoy is active, the allied team has additional respawn points close to it. The enemy team will also have respawn points at a distance from the convoy. Based on players feedback and further tests it will be decided whether or not to leave enemy respawn points or change them. The number of ships in the convoy depends on the number of players in the game session and on the port size where the convoy is attempting to reach.
  • New scenario for Enduring Confrontation: port attack. Each team will have 3 ports at the start of the mission. Each port has several AI ships which will defend the base. Each port is immediately available for players to capture and there are no additional tasks for capturing the ports. If the convoy from the “naval convoy” scenario reaches its port it is very likely that the AI ships from this port will attack one of the enemy ports and the players will receive additional points for helping them to capture enemy port.
  • New scenario for Enduring Confrontation: naval bombers. In case there is an active naval convoy on the map the enemy team may have a bomber which will attack and destroy the convoy. The entire logic of the scenario is working in the same way as for ordinary bombers attacking ground bases, but now their targets are convoy ships.
  • [Enduring Confrontation] English Channel is now the mission for combined naval battles (ships and aircraft). In this mission only the allied team will receive additional respawns close to convoy.
  • New mission [Enduring Confrontation] Saipan in which is represented only with naval and aircraft which play a secondary role. In this mission, with the appearance of the convoy both teams will receive additional respawns (allied- close to the convoy, enemy - farther away from the convoy).

Ground Vehicle model, damage model, characteristic and weaponry changes

  • The damage model for large modules, units and assemblies like the breech, transmission and engines has been reworked. Now, those modules use volumetric technology. So the protecting effect of these modules depends on the trajectory of the shell inside them and the point from which the secondary fragments will be generated by the penetration is now the point of "exit" from the module.

  • SAM missiles have had a restriction on the operation of a non-contact fuse at low altitudes added. If the missile's flight altitude is less than 25 meters above the surface, the non-contact fuse will not be activated and the target can only be hit with a direct hit of the missile.
  • A number of modern IR-guided missiles (Mistral, Eagle and Stinger) have received protection against interference, which makes IRCM completely ineffective. Flares can be effective only at a very high rate of fire (at least 3 times per second).
  • Slope effect values for AP rounds have been specified for striking angles of 40-65 degrees. Penetration in this angular range has been increased. 
  • Penetration values for APCR/HVAP shells have been specified by the appropriate calculation method.
  • Tail fuse presets have been reconsidered in APHE rounds. Armour thickness values for fuse arming have been changed:
    • Small calibres (through 57mm): 9mm;
    • Medium calibres (from 57 through 90mm):14mm; 
    • Large calibres (over 90mm): 19mm;

Flight Model changes

  • Helicopters (all) - rotor and anti-torque propeller physics has been improved. Pitch speed now affects the rotor’s thrust speed and roll trim. When flying with high pitch speeds, which is close to critical, the excessive roll towards retreating rotor blade is taking effect. Helicopter flight characteristics have been specified (max speeds, climb rates, etc.). The max pitch setting rate and swash plate speed have been increased. Anti-torque pitch control speed has also been increased for more precise helicopter control (to provide sturdier connection between controls and whashplate and anti-torque propeller, set the max sensitivity and zero dead-air zone). Rotor thrust in axial flow on low speeds has been adjusted: climb rate goes to maximum when thrust is increasing.

  • The visual effect of the flame part of a jet afterburner for aircraft with jet engines has been reworked. For jet aircraft with a jet chamber the flame will appears only when the jet chamber is operational. When operating in non WEP modes and also for jets without the jet chamber, the flame part will not be displayed, only the visual part of the exhaust and hot air jet.

Interface

  • The indicators for the ground and aircraft radars have been improved. On the all round view indicator, the target marker will now be displayed as an arc segment (as in reality). The size of the capture markers has been increased. Displaying the radar operating area, search area and target capture area has been added. An indication for tracking failures at radial speed (capture frame flashing) has been added. The indicator of the level of interfering reflections from the ground has been added.
    Displaying the radar coverage area has been added to the HUD.
  • On-board target tracking radars in fighters now continuously search for targets and lock on to them for tracking until they are turned off.
  • A separate indicator for RWR (radar warning receiver) which shows the direction on the radar more accurately and also shows the mode of them has been added. Also when warning radar position detects radar it will  create a sound alarm. The previous indication in the form of arrows at the edges of the screen has been removed.
